SHILLONG:
The search for Marshal Marwein, a 30-year-old man buried alive in Marten on February 3, has reached its conclusion.
Today, the search and rescue team, comprising members of the State Disaster Response Force (SDRF), other ragpickers, municipality workers, and others, successfully located his body.
Yesterday, the search and rescue operation had to be suspended due to low visibility. However, resuming their efforts at 9 am today, the team persisted in their mission.
According to reports, on February 3, Marwein had arrived in Marten after collecting waste from the city. While planning to gather scrap, a sudden collapse of the garbage dump occurred, burying him alive. Originally from Mawkyrwat, Marwein resided in Mawiong and is survived by his wife and two children.
